BACKGROUND
The Denton Energy Center (DEC) is an approved CIP project for DME. The DEC project within the Renewable Denton Plan, will assist in providing energy services and back up to renewable sources, when they are both in low and excess output. The DEC is a component of the City of Denton's future commitment to providing citizens with 70% of electricity from renewable sources of energy.

The DEC will require city water for plant personnel facilities, engine cooling and miscellaneous plant operations and cleaning. The water line will tie in to an existing water main, which was completed in DEC Phase 1 water line project, at the north east corner of DEC and loop around to an existing water main at Jim Christal Road and Masch Branch. The looped water supply will insure the required water volume for the plant's fire suppression system. Exhibit 3 details the connection points and alignment of the Phase 2 water line.

The DEC will require sanitary sewer service connection to the city sanitary sewer facilities. The connection point will be on the east side of the Denton Enterprise Airport, along Masch Branch Road. The sewer line will cross airport property. FAA approval for work within the airport boundaries, has been granted to this project. See Exhibit 3 for the project map.

The IFB was advertised in accordance with Materials Management procedures. The main bid contained a pricing option for the City to upsize a portion of the water main from 16" to 20" and an alternate pricing option for no upsize. Ten responsive proposals were received.
